Fig. 1 is a piping diagram of a freezer cooler showing an embodiment of the present invention, Fig. 2 is a refrigeration cycle diagram incorporating the cooler shown in Fig. 1, and Fig. 3 is an electrical wiring diagram incorporating a control device. FIG. 4 is an overall longitudinal sectional view of a freezer incorporating the cooler of FIG. 1, and FIG. 5 is an overall longitudinal sectional view of a conventional example. 10a...first cooler, 12...second cooler,
17... Refrigerant flow path inlet section, 21... Bypass pipe,
22...control valve, 23...pressure reducing device.
